Résumés are so passé. Poke New York is ditching the old cover letter, résumé and book routine in its search for interns. Instead, it will choose from videos that candidates upload to Vimeo. "Introduce yourself! Showcase your skills! Shave your cat! Whatever it takes. (No RickRolling pls)," the digital shop implores. These kinds of open pitch videos, of course, can go awry.
